Transaction fa2bbdcfab708a0fdd32ddeb6e35c631285f78d1003dcac631d95dc2ed77aa4c
1 Input
1 Outputs
- fa2bbdcfab708a0fdd32ddeb6e35c631285f78d1003dcac631d95dc2ed77aa4c:0
value 757039
address 1LdsMSuNhyrAzprmkAo4GmKnYJknHiK43D